Web31 mrt. 2024 · Mohawk, self-name Kanien’kehá:ka (“People of the Flint”), Iroquoian -speaking North American Indian tribe and the easternmost tribe of the Iroquois (Haudenosaunee) Confederacy. Within the confederacy …
WebLocation, Land, and Climate The earliest known Mohawk villages were on the St. Lawrence River near Montreal. In 1535, when rivals drove them south, the Mohawk built three fortified villages along the Mohawk River in northeast New York. Mohawk is a northern Iroquoian language spoken by Mohawk Indians at six reserves in Canada and the United States: Akwesasne (St. Regis) Reserve, located partly in upper New York State and partly in the Canadian provinces of Ontario and Quebec; Six Nations Reserve, located in Ontario; Gibson Reserve, Ontario; Tyendinaga Reserve, …

Web29 nov. 2024 · Dutch, Mohawk & Mohican Fur Trade. November 29, 2024 by Peter Hess 1 Comment. After a 1627 conflict, when the Dutch sided with the Mahicans against the Mohawks, the relationship between the first settlers and the Indigenous People was relatively peaceful and cooperative.
